The elusive black panther, a creature shrouded in mystique and legend, has captivated the world for centuries. This nocturnal predator, known for its sleek Ebony coat and powerful presence, is often the subject of folklore and rumors. While many believe it to be a distinct species, the truth is somewhat more nuanced. The black panther isn't actually a separate creature but rather a melanistic form of two existing felines: the leopard and the jaguar.
Melanism, a genetic condition resulting in increased melanin production, gives these animals their characteristic dark pelage. This trait can occur in various mammals, but it's particularly striking in leopards and jaguars.
- Consequently, the scientific name for a black panther depends on its actual species. A black leopard is scientifically known as Panthera pardus, while a black jaguar is called Panthera onca.

The Elusive Black Panther: Its Scientific Identity Revealed
For vast years, the black panther has captivated imagination with its mysterious presence. Often confused for a separate species, recent studies have shed insight on the true nature of this enigmatic creature.
The black panther is not, in fact, a distinct species but rather a dark-colored variant of two existing big cats: the leopard and the jaguar. This phenomenon, known as melanism, occurs when an animal possesses an abundance of melanin, the pigment responsible for deep brown coloration.
The increased melanin offers these animals superior concealment in their native habitats, particularly within dense forests and shadowy areas.
